Make Merry With My Heart

Between the arches stands a burning flame
A scarlet flare with subtle hints of blue
Where dreams are traced and love divine is drew
As all the sparking embers, spell a name.
Behind carved locks I gaze into the orb,
As mists of time, make merry with my heart
The secret words are said and clouds depart
My destiny I dare not yet absorb.
Repeated questions asked of runes tonight,
Then cards across the table, silence dealt
Before the sacred altar where I'm knelt
I pray to fate for even more insight.
There is so much I want, I need to know
As now I stand before love's portico
